6. FEEDING
1. Tilt the machine head onto the support pin.
2. Adjustment of feeding wheels
Turn the hand wheel counter-clockwise until the guiding
spring snaps into the shifter left arm notch. The feeding
lever is on the very top point of the feeding cam. Dismantle
the gearwheel safety cover and loosen the screws , on
the horizontal gearwheels and the crank drive screw .
3. Loosen two adjusting screws in the right ring .
Pressing the end of the feeding shaft against the right
ring you adjust the distance between the left ring and
the end of the feeding shaft Ï to 11 mm. Tighten the
adjusting screws on the right ring . This is the right
tension adjustment of the left ring on the shaft.
4. Place the right gearwheel into the gearing with the
vertical wheel secure its position with setscrews .
5. Turn the hand wheel counter clockwise until the guiding
spring snaps into the shifter right arm notch. The feeding
lever is on the very bottom point of the feeding cam. Place
the left gearwheel into the gearing with the vertical
wheel secure its position with setscrews . Push the
crank drive towards the left gearwheel and secure it with
the screw .
You have set up the position of the feeding wheels. Turn the hand
wheel to finish the sewing cycle and bring the machine into the
home position. Mount the wheel safety cover on.
6. The feeding always starts, in other words the clamp plate
moves, when the needle is out of the fabric, and it is in the
position when the needle tip is right above the fabric.
7. Use a sheet of paper to do the adjustment. You will clearly
see needle punctures.
If the adjustment is incorrect, set the machine into such a
sewing position so that the guiding spring snaps into a
shifter arm notch.
Loosen the screws on the feeding cam
and adjust its
position so that the clamp plate moves in the moment of the
needle being out of the fabric (above the paper).Tighten the
setscrews.
